More Walk-Bys Mod
In the regular game, a sim from the neighborhood will walk by your house four times a day, at 10 a.m., 2 p.m., 4 p.m., and 10 p.m. These walk-bys are very useful, since you can make friends with them or raise your Social need without having to leave your home lot.
But their timing isn't very convenient. At 10 a.m. and 2 p.m., my sims are usually at work. Sometimes we're at work at 4 p.m., too. And by 10 p.m., my sims are usually pretty tired, far too low in Energy to stand around chatting for a couple of hours.
So I've increased the number of walk-bys. You evidently live in a very healthy neighborhood, because a LOT of your neighbors go for walks! :-) Sims will walk by your house every hour between 7 a.m. and 10 p.m. if there are enough sims in your neighborhood to do so. (If there aren't enough sims, make some more! :-D It's good to have at least a few sims who don't have jobs in your neighborhood, so they'll be available to walk by at any hour.)
If your sims live in a house with only one sidewalk, the walk-by sim should walk right past your house, so it's easy for your sim to see and greet the walk-by. If your sims live in a corner lot -- one with sidewalks on TWO sides of your lot -- you may occasionally have to look closely to catch the walk-bys, because sometimes they come in one side and go out the other side, spending very little time actually visible. 6 Sim Lane is especially bad in this regard, as you can see in the picture below. But if you know the time when sims generally walk by, you should be able to catch them. In my game, sims usually enter the lot at around 20 minutes past the hour, so 7:20, 8:20, 9:20, and so on.
